
Cost of Underground Gas Line Service in Irving
The cost of underground gas line service in Irving, TX can vary based on numerous factors. Whether you are installing a new gas line or repairing an existing one, understanding these cost components can help you budget effectively. This guide provides insights into the factors that influence the cost and gives an overview of common tasks and their associated expenses.
Factors Affecting Cost
- Length of the Gas Line: Longer gas lines require more materials and labor, increasing the overall cost.
- Type of Piping Material: Different materials such as copper, PVC, or polyethylene have varying costs.
- Depth of the Installation: Deeper installations may require more extensive excavation, thus raising the price.
- Permits and Inspections: Local regulations may necessitate permits and inspections, adding to the total cost.
- Labor Costs: Labor rates can vary based on the complexity of the job and the expertise required.
- Accessibility: Hard-to-reach areas may require special equipment or additional labor, increasing costs.
- Additional Services: Additional services like trenching, backfilling, and landscaping restoration can add to the total expense.
Common Tasks and Costs
Task | Average Cost (USD) |
---|---|
New Gas Line Installation | $1,500 - $3,000 |
Gas Line Repair | $300 - $1,000 |
Gas Line Replacement | $2,000 - $5,000 |
Trenching and Excavation | $500 - $1,500 |
Permits and Inspections | $100 - $300 |
Pressure Testing and Inspection | $100 - $200 |
Connection to Gas Meter | $200 - $500 |
